Also I was wondering if there was way to do the dynamic instrumentation
"in-band" if that makes sense. (Like using a separate thread in the same
process so that there is no need to have a separate mutator process to
do it.)
There have been various projects in the group over the years that do
in-band (or first-party, as we refer to it) instrumentation. As far as
I know, none of them have taken a separate thread approach. There's
also Dyninst's binary rewriting mode, where the
parsing/codegen/instrumentation process occurs once up-front and then
you run the instrumented binary on its own.
